I have the 8.2 for the K+ and yes I can burn it. It's a 27C1001 Eprom.
Price would depend on what you already have, if your Kam has a UV erasable
firmware Eprom then its not that big of a deal, just ship the Kam to me and
I can just pull the current Eprom, erase, reprogram, test, and its ready to
go back. It's a lot easier to fix any problems here than send you a chip
and find out you have a corrupt burn or something like that. If yours has
the OTP, one time programmable Eprom without a window on the top then I
would have to order a replacement. Mouser carries them for about $5 and
then another $9 or so for shipping, I could get you an exact price quote if
it turns out you have an OTP in there now.
At the most, minus the Eprom if needed, $20 to cover the cost of shipping it
back and a little money for my time and the beer fund.
